For the second straight game, Red Springs will face off against Whiteville. The Red Devils will square off against the Wolfpack at 6:00 p.m. on Friday. Red Springs has given up an average of 8.7 runs per game this season, but Friday's game will give them a chance to turn things around.
Red Springs is coming in off a wild two-game stretch: after soaring to 17 runs on Monday, they were much more limited against Whiteville on Tuesday. They lost 18-2 to the Wolfpack.
The victory was the third in a row for Whiteville, bringing their record up to 12-6. The wins came thanks in part to their hitting performance across that stretch, as they averaged 14.7 runs over those games. As for Red Springs, they have been struggling recently as they've lost nine of their last ten contests. That's put a noticeable dent in their 7-11 record this season.
